Army Paratrooper Fatally Injured In Training Exercise

Was Participating In A Free Fall Training Jump In Arizona

A U.S. Army soldier was fatally injured Tuesday in a free fall training exercise near Elroy, AZ.

Fox News reports that the soldier has not been identified, but the accident was confirmed by Army Special Operations Command spokesperson Lt. Col. Loren Bymer.

Bymer said no additional information was immediately available due to an ongoing investigation into the accident.

The Army Times reports that Special Operations forces commonly train at Elroy, which is about three hours east of the Yuma Proving Grounds where the basic military freefall courses are conducted. Private companies run training courses at Elroy, operating from the Elroy Municipal Airport.

Last February, three members of the U.S. Army parachute demonstration team The Golden Knights were injured in a similar accident at Homestead Air Reserve Base near Miami. FL.
